Specialties & Taxonomies

  • Dentist

    Prosthodontics

    Dental Providers

    Primary

    That branch of dentistry pertaining to the restoration and maintenance of oral functions, comfort, appearance and health of the patient by the restoration of natural teeth and/or the replacement of missing teeth and contiguous oral and maxillofacial tissues with artificial substitutes.

    Taxonomy code 1223P0700X
  • Dentist

    General Practice

    Dental Providers

    A general dentist is the primary dental care provider for patients of all ages. The general dentist is responsible for the diagnosis, treatment, management and overall coordination of services related to patients' oral health needs.

    Taxonomy code 1223G0001X
